Is timesaving hyphenated or not

The term "timesaving" is typically written without a hyphen. It is considered a compound adjective used to describe something that saves time. However, in some contexts, especially when used as a noun, it might appear as "time-saving." Always check the specific style guide you are following, as preferences may vary.
